Out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female in Canada
Canada: Out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female was 15.1% in 2025. ▲ Rising
Out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female in Canada, 2000–2025
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2025, out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female in Canada stood at 15.1%. That is the highest value across all 26 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 5.6% on the previous year and up 46.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female in Canada peaked at 15.1% in 2025 and was at its lowest, 9.2%, in 2004.
That places Canada 105th out of 206 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.
Out-of-school rate for youth of upper secondary school age, female in Canada,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 11.6% | — |
| 2001 | 11.5% | -0.9% |
| 2002 | 11.4% | -0.9% |
| 2003 | 11.4% | +0.0% |
| 2004 | 9.2% | -19.3% |
| 2005 | 9.3% | +1.1% |
| 2006 | 9.4% | +1.1% |
| 2007 | 9.5% | +1.1% |
| 2008 | 9.5% | +0.0% |
| 2009 | 9.7% | +2.1% |
| 2010 | 9.6% | -1.0% |
| 2011 | 9.5% | -1.0% |
| 2012 | 11.8% | +24.2% |
| 2013 | 11.5% | -2.5% |
| 2014 | 11.0% | -4.3% |
| 2015 | 10.3% | -6.4% |
| 2016 | 9.6% | -6.8% |
| 2017 | 9.5% | -1.0% |
| 2018 | 10.1% | +6.3% |
| 2019 | 11.2% | +10.9% |
| 2020 | 12.3% | +9.8% |
| 2021 | 13.0% | +5.7% |
| 2022 | 13.3% | +2.3% |
| 2023 | 13.8% | +3.8% |
| 2024 | 14.3% | +3.6% |
| 2025 | 15.1% | +5.6% |
